In today’s rapidly changing world, the 4 Cs of the 21st century have become essential skills for success in both personal and professional spheres These 21st-century skills are critical thinking, creativity, communication, and collaboration Let’s delve deeper into each of these crucial attributes and understand why they are important in our modern world.
The first C, critical thinking, is the ability to analyze information objectively and make informed decisions In the age of fake news and misinformation, critical thinking has become more important than ever Individuals must be able to sift through vast amounts of data, separate facts from opinions, and evaluate the credibility of sources Critical thinkers can see through biases and propaganda and form their own well-reasoned opinions.
Moreover, critical thinking is not just about solving problems; it also involves asking the right questions By questioning assumptions and challenging the status quo, critical thinkers can come up with innovative solutions to complex problems Employers seek critical thinkers who can adapt to changing circumstances and think on their feet In a world where technology is evolving at breakneck speed, the ability to think critically is a valuable asset.
The second C, creativity, is the ability to generate new ideas and think outside the box In a competitive global economy, creativity is what sets individuals apart from machines While automation can handle routine tasks, it is human creativity that drives innovation and pushes boundaries Creative individuals can envision possibilities that others overlook and turn their ideas into reality.

The third C, communication, is the ability to convey ideas effectively and build relationships with others In a world that is increasingly interconnected, communication has become more important than ever Whether through spoken language, written word, or visual media, effective communication is essential for success in both personal and professional settings.
Good communicators can express themselves clearly, listen actively to others, and tailor their message to different audiences By mastering the art of communication, individuals can connect with others on a deeper level, resolve conflicts peacefully, and inspire others to action Employers value strong communicators who can work well in teams, build rapport with clients, and represent their organization effectively.
The fourth C, collaboration, is the ability to work effectively with others towards a common goal In today’s global economy, collaboration is essential for success Whether within a team, across departments, or with partners around the world, individuals must be able to collaborate seamlessly to achieve results.
Collaborative individuals can leverage the strengths of others, share resources, and combine their expertise to solve complex problems By working together, teams can achieve more than any individual could on their own and drive innovation through collective effort Employers seek collaborative employees who can thrive in a diverse and interconnected world.
